2010 Season Highlights
 Stan Parrish enters his 2nd season as Head Coach at Ball State.
 
2010 Season
 Date   Opponent  Score   
 Thu., Sep. 2  vs. Southeast Missouri State  27   10   W       
 Sat., Sep. 11  vs. Liberty  23   27   L       
 Sat., Sep. 18  @ Purdue  13   24   L       
 Sat., Sep. 25  @ Iowa  0   45   L       
 Sat., Oct. 2  @ Central Michigan  31   17   W       
 Sat., Oct. 9  vs. Western Michigan  16   45   L       
 Sat., Oct. 16  vs. Eastern Michigan  38   41   L       
 Sat., Oct. 23  @ Toledo  24   31   L       
 Sat., Oct. 30  @ Kent State  14   33   L       
 Sat., Nov. 6  vs. Akron  37   30   W       
 Fri., Nov. 12  @ Buffalo  20   3   W       
 Sat., Nov. 20  vs. Northern Illinois  21   59   L       
 
2010 Season Totals
  Record4-8
  Points Scored264
  Scoring Average22.0
  Points Allowed365
  Defense Average30.4
  Opponents Record58-77
  Conference Record3-5
  Home Record2-4
  Away Record2-4
